软件项目管理论文提纲

2022-11-15

论文题目:基于敏捷开发的D公司软件项目管理过程优化研究

摘要:D公司是一家以提供信息化解决方案为主的传统软件企业,主要为政府及大中型企业提供软件开发等信息技术服务。D公司开发模式以瀑布模型为主,但近几年在瀑布模型的应用过程中发现了一系列问题,一是客户需求不明确、变更频繁,按照瀑布模型把全部需求落实清楚变得越来越困难;二是整个开发过程用户参与度低、和客户互动很少,出现问题不容易及时纠正和解决,导致系统上线后问题不断,后期运维压力非常大;三是开发周期过长且不透明,出现问题修正成本高。敏捷开发是一种通过快速迭代以适应客户频繁变更需求的开发方法,通常适用于互联网产品、自主运营软件等可迭代交付的项目。在D公司敏捷开发的实践中,受项目特点、客户方项目管理要求等限制,如项目不允许增量式交付、客户不能和项目组一起工作、客户方项目管理规范性要求和节点控制仍是瀑布模型为主、客户对文档规范性要求严格等,直接将敏捷开发应用于传统软件项目的效果并不理想。基于上述问题,本文对D公司软件项目管理过程进行了基于敏捷开发的优化研究,在符合客户方管理要求及项目自身特点的前提下,对需求分析、系统开发、系统测试等项目过程进行优化。为了解决D公司软件项目管理过程优化的问题,首先,通过收集资料,研究了软件项目管理、敏捷开发、瀑布模型等相关理论和方法,作为本文研究的理论基础。其次,对D公司软件项目管理现状及问题进行分析,分析D公司在项目管理、项目组织形式上的现状以及瀑布模型在需求分析、系统开发、系统测试等过程使用中的问题,明确了D公司软件项目管理过程优化的方向。再次,基于对当前存在问题的深入分析,利用敏捷开发的方法和思想进行相应的优化方案设计,在需求过程中利用用户故事获取和引导需求、利用原型法对需求进行描述和确认;在开发过程中引入Sprint划分,引入站立会议、评审会议等敏捷沟通方式,利用燃尽图对项目进度进行可视化管理;在测试过程中加强持续集成测试、自动化测试方法的应用。最后,以D公司J软件项目研发作为案例,进行优化方案的实施并对实施效果进行评价。实施结果证明,通过项目管理过程的优化,达到让整个项目更可控的目的,提高项目的整体交付能力,提高客户满意度和公司的市场竞争力。综上所述,本文基于敏捷方法对D公司软件项目管理过程进行优化,在符合传统软件项目特点和客户方管理要求的前提下,最大程度地解决当前瀑布模型中的项目管理问题。软件项目管理优化方案的实施提高了软件项目在不同过程中的敏捷程度、交互能力和迭代能力,提升了项目的可控性和客户满意度,也为同类型软件公司的项目管理过程优化提供了可借鉴的范例。

关键词:敏捷开发;瀑布模型;软件项目管理;过程优化

学科专业:MBA(专业学位)

中文摘要

ABSTRACT

第1章 绪论

1.1 研究背景

1.2 研究目的和意义

1.3 研究方法

1.4 研究内容与框架结构

1.5 论文创新点

第2章 相关文献综述

2.1 软件项目管理

2.2 瀑布模型

2.3 敏捷开发

第3章 D公司软件项目管理现状及问题分析

3.1 D公司软件项目管理现状

3.1.1 软件开发流程现状

3.1.2 项目组织形式现状

3.2 D公司软件项目管理过程存在问题分析

3.2.1 需求分析过程问题分析

3.2.2 系统开发过程问题分析

3.2.3 系统测试过程问题分析

3.3 D公司组织架构存在问题分析

第4章 D公司软件项目管理过程及组织架构优化方案设计

4.1 基于敏捷开发的项目管理过程优化方案设计

4.1.1 需求分析过程优化方案设计

4.1.2 系统开发过程优化方案设计

4.1.3 系统测试过程优化方案设计

4.2 组织架构优化方案设计

4.2.1 增加产品经理角色

4.2.2 基于业务行业的组织架构调整设计

4.2.3 公共支撑中台设计

第5章 优化方案的实施及效果评价

5.1 案例项目选择

5.2 项目团队组织

5.3 项目实施过程

5.3.1 需求分析过程优化方案实施

5.3.2 系统开发过程优化方案实施

5.3.3 系统测试过程优化方案实施

5.4 项目实施效果评价

第6章 结论与展望

6.1 结论

6.2 展望

参考文献

致谢

上一篇:畜牧市场论文提纲下一篇:金融工程学论文提纲